3 books
Sacha Lamb, author of the debut novel When the Angels Left the Old Country, is a 2018 Lambda Literary Fellow in young adult fiction, and graduated in library and information science and history from Simmons University.
The Forbidden Book
When the Angels Left the Old Country
Avi Cantor Has Six Months to Live